brcmfmac: introduce brcmf_fw_alloc_request() function
authorArend Van Spriel <arend.vanspriel@broadcom.com>
Thu, 22 Mar 2018 20:28:27 +0000 (21:28 +0100)
committerKalle Valo <kvalo@codeaurora.org>
Tue, 27 Mar 2018 09:04:31 +0000 (12:04 +0300)
commit2baa3aaee27f137b8db9a9224d0fe9b281d28e34
treebb0013d09fb3d92ae88935bc7f4a6c7cfb8f4496
parentd09ae51a4b676151edaf572bcd5f272b5532639f
brcmfmac: introduce brcmf_fw_alloc_request() function

The function brcmf_fw_alloc_request() takes a list of required files
and allocated the struct brcmf_fw_request instance accordingly. The
request can be modified by the caller before being passed to the
brcmf_fw_request_firmwares() function.

Reviewed-by: Hante Meuleman <hante.meuleman@broadcom.com>
Reviewed-by: Pieter-Paul Giesberts <pieter-paul.giesberts@broadcom.com>
Reviewed-by: Franky Lin <franky.lin@broadcom.com>
Signed-off-by: Arend van Spriel <arend.vanspriel@broadcom.com>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
drivers/net/wireless/broadcom/brcm80211/brcmfmac/firmware.c
drivers/net/wireless/broadcom/brcm80211/brcmfmac/firmware.h
drivers/net/wireless/broadcom/brcm80211/brcmfmac/pcie.c
drivers/net/wireless/broadcom/brcm80211/brcmfmac/sdio.c
drivers/net/wireless/broadcom/brcm80211/brcmfmac/usb.c